4.5.4

Wiring protective earth

Install protective earth by connecting all exposed inactive metal parts that do not belong to
the operational power circuit to ground potential. This conductive connection is intended to
prevent the development of dangerous voltages on electrically conductive system or device
parts in the case of malfunction.
Electrical accident through contact
The RAIL contact conductors are connected to 48 V AC, while the L1, L2 and L3 contact
conductors are operated on a voltage of 400/500 V AC. Contact with components carrying
these live voltages poses the risk of an electrical accident. Such an accident can result in
physical injury or death.
Always adhere to the necessary safety measures taken for the respective electrical system
components.
Note
Note that a leakage current > 10 mA can flow across the PE connections to the PE contact
conductor.
